0 CVE-2025-69991 is a critical SQL Injection vulnerability found in the phpgurukul News Portal Project version 4.1, specifically in the check_availablity.php script. This flaw allows unauthenticated remote attackers to execute arbitrary SQL commands due to improper input sanitization. The vulnerability has a CVSS score of 9.8, indicating high impact on confidentiality, integrity, and availability without requiring user interaction or privileges. Exploitation could lead to full database compromise, data leakage, or complete system takeover. Although no known exploits are reported in the wild yet, the critical severity demands immediate attention. European organizations using this software, especially media outlets or news portals, face significant risks. Mitigation involves applying patches when available, implementing strict input validation, and employing web application firewalls.
